Return of Eminger

The Rangers appear to have looked at the free agent market, and decided re-signing the known commodity was the better option. As predicted by Larry Brooks last week, the Rangers have signed Eminger for another year, albeit at the slightly lower rate of $800,000.

The move means the Rangers now have five proven defensemen on the roster and a number of candidates for the final position. Tim Erixon appears to have the edge for the final spot, and it would not be surprising to see another veteran defenseman or two invited to camp on a try-out basis.
